Corona pass of half a million unboosted people will expire on Friday

The corona admission ticket (CTB) of more than half a million people will expire next Friday because they have not yet received a booster shot. Minister Kuipers writes to the House of Representatives that a maximum of 540,000 people are involved.

The validity of the CTB is limited to 180 days after infection and 270 days after vaccination. People who had their last shot before 1 May (one shot from Janssen or two from another approved vaccine) therefore need a booster to be able to travel without additional conditions. The validity of the booster is unlimited for the time being.

According to Kuipers, the shorter validity period may lead to more people getting a booster vaccination. The corona pass for access to, among other things, catering and cultural institutions can also be obtained after a negative test result or if you have recovered from corona.
